Expert Review: Clarion Hotel Mestari

Clarion Hotel Mestari, Helsinki: A Michelin Key Selected Urban Oasis

Clarion Hotel Mestari, a Michelin Key Selected property in the heart of Helsinki, consistently garners high praise for its exceptional location, stylish design, and outstanding guest experience. Situated in a historic building with an industrial-chic aesthetic, this 4-star hotel offers a modern and comfortable stay, making it a highly recommended choice for travelers to the Finnish capital.

2. Key Highlights

Guests consistently laud the hotel's prime location, its delicious and varied breakfast, modern and spotless facilities, and the friendly, helpful staff. The unique industrial interior design, reminiscent of the 1960s, set within the historic "House of Master Builders," also stands out as a key highlight, creating a distinctive and stylish atmosphere. Amenities such as a fitness center, sauna, and free WiFi are also appreciated.

3. Room Quality

The rooms at Clarion Hotel Mestari are frequently described as clean, new, updated, and well-designed. They offer 4-star comfort with air-conditioning, private bathrooms, minibars, work desks, soundproofing, and free WiFi. Guests often note the beds as very comfortable, although one guest mentioned a bed being "a bit too soft." While some rooms are noted as being "a bit small," they are well-equipped and cozy. A recurring comment, particularly from Western travelers, is the use of two single duvets on a large king-size bed, which some found disappointing. Deluxe rooms may include a balcony and offer city views.

4. Dining Experience

The dining experience, particularly breakfast, receives exceptional reviews. Guests describe it as "amazing," "superb," "delicious," and "first-rate," offering a broad choice of hot and cold food options. The spacious breakfast restaurant provides numerous stations including scrambled eggs, sausages, bacon, crepes, assorted pastries, cured meats, cheeses, yogurts, vegetables, and a dedicated gluten-free station.

For other meals, the hotel features Maestro51, an à la carte restaurant serving Latin American cuisine with vegetarian, vegan, and gluten-free options. The Social Bar & Bistro offers bistro classics with a modern twist, a wide selection of beers, quality European wines, and non-alcoholic choices in a stylish setting.

6. Location & Accessibility

Clarion Hotel Mestari boasts an excellent and central location in the Kamppi district, making it highly accessible. It's just a 10-minute walk from Helsinki Central Station and a short stroll from the Kamppi Shopping Centre. Major attractions like the Helsinki Music Center, Helsinki Cathedral, and the modern Temppeliaukio Church (Rock Church) are all within easy reach. Public transport, including metro and tram stops, is very close by, allowing for easy exploration of the city. The surrounding area also offers plenty of restaurants and bars.

7. Value & Pricing

The hotel is highly rated for its value for money. While specific price ranges vary, some listings indicate prices from approximately €218 per night. Additional costs include public parking on-site at around €36 per day, and a pet fee of €30 per pet per night (maximum €40 per stay). Breakfast is typically included in the stay.

8. Common Complaints

Despite the overwhelmingly positive feedback, a few minor recurring issues have been noted by guests:

  • Bed softness and linen: Some guests found the bed a "bit too soft." The practice of using two single duvets on a large king bed was also a point of disappointment for some.
  • Sound insulation: Minor sound issues from the street or through walls were occasionally reported.
  • Shower size/pressure: A few guests mentioned a cramped shower feeling or weak water pressure.
